The first 500 or so miles you are wearing off the worst parts of the tire. By 1000 miles you should have a better feel for how the tire will work. For better sponse, run higher in the front. I push my cars pretty hard and usually run 36-38psi in the front tires on FWD cars. Wehn autocrossing, 45-50psi is common.

If nothing helps, I just take it as one more example of not ot buy store brand tires.

Just a thought: I just got the bridgestone potenza re950 because I'd had enough of the goodyear eagles that came with the car. The difference is like night and day....feels like a different car. Steering response is better, they look good, grip is better and they are quieter. Only downfall is that they ride a little firmer....but it's worth it to me. I'm running 205 60 15 on mine.
